How To Calibrate A Baby Scale. The process varies by model but generally follows this procedure: Calibrating a digital scale is a straightforward process that involves cleaning and preparing the scale, turning it on and letting it warm up, entering calibration mode, adding calibration weights or coins, removing the weights and checking for a “pass” message, and testing the scale’s measurements with a known weight.
